UAE Begins Historic Push to Move 50% of Federal Government Work to Agentic AI

 


The United Arab Emirates is moving beyond AI assistants and chatbots.

It now wants artificial intelligence systems capable of planning, executing tasks, coordinating actions, and in some cases making decisions with greater autonomy to become part of the machinery of government itself.

More than 100 federal officials joined a workshop in Dubai in August to launch the strategic track of the UAE's Agentic AI Project, a national initiative targeting the transformation of 50 percent of federal government operations, services, and tasks into agentic AI-driven models within two years.

The workshop, organised by the National Committee for the Agentic AI Project, focused on something much more consequential than choosing an AI platform.

Officials began developing frameworks for determining which government tasks should be handled by AI, how those tasks should be classified, and how federal agencies should coordinate their deployments without duplicating systems.

From AI Strategy to Agentic Government

The UAE has spent nearly a decade preparing for this transition.

In October 2017, it launched the UAE Strategy for Artificial Intelligence, positioning AI as a central component of its long-term government and economic strategy.

That same period saw the appointment of Omar Sultan Al Olama as Minister of State for Artificial Intelligence, making the UAE the first country to establish such a ministerial position. His portfolio was later expanded to include the digital economy and remote work applications.

But the government's latest initiative represents a significant escalation.

On April 23, 2026, Sheikh Mohammed bin Rashid Al Maktoum, Vice President and Prime Minister of the UAE and Ruler of Dubai, announced a government framework designed to shift 50 percent of government sectors, services, and operations toward Agentic AI within two years.

Unlike conventional generative AI, which typically waits for a user to ask a question or issue a prompt, agentic AI systems can potentially:

  • interpret an objective
  • break it into multiple tasks
  • retrieve information
  • interact with software systems
  • initiate workflows
  • evaluate results
  • take additional actions
  • escalate exceptions to humans

In other words, the ambition is not simply for AI to answer government employees.

It is for AI increasingly to perform government work.

"Human Leads, AI Enables"

The August workshop introduced an important principle for the programme:

"Human leads, AI enables."

That statement matters because it establishes, at least at the policy level, that artificial intelligence is intended to operate under human-led governance.

But it also creates one of the central questions surrounding the project.

When the initiative was originally announced, Sheikh Mohammed described Agentic AI systems capable of managing operations and carrying out sequences of actions without human intervention. The UAE government also described the programme as enabling more autonomous execution and decision-making.

Those two concepts are not necessarily contradictory.

An AI agent could autonomously execute routine administrative processes while humans retain authority over high-impact decisions.

The challenge is deciding where exactly that boundary sits.

That is why the task-classification framework being developed by the UAE could ultimately be more important than the AI models themselves.

Seven Areas of Government Are Being Examined

The strategic government track covers seven major areas:

  1. Strategy and projects
  2. Foresight and strategic intelligence
  3. Policies
  4. Structures and governance
  5. Government performance
  6. Global competitiveness
  7. Innovation in government work

Officials at the August workshop also discussed implementation timelines, performance indicators, task classification, coordination between agencies, and methods for reducing duplication.

Huda Al Hashimi, Deputy Minister of Cabinet Affairs for Strategic Affairs, described the programme as entering its operational stage for applying AI models to strategic government work.

That makes this different from many government AI initiatives.

The UAE is not limiting agentic systems to answering citizen inquiries or automating simple transactions.

It is exploring AI in areas involving policy development, strategic foresight, institutional performance, and government decision support.

UAE Already Has AI Agents Working in Government

The project is not purely theoretical.

During a national government retreat in May, the UAE unveiled its first group of specialised government AI agents.

They included:

  • Procurement AI Agent
  • Tax Auditing AI Agent
  • Customer Happiness AI Agent
  • Technical Support AI Agent

The procurement agent is designed to assist sourcing and procurement workflows, while the tax auditing agent supports tax reviews and data verification.

These are significant testing grounds because procurement and taxation involve structured rules, large volumes of data, financial consequences, and established audit processes.

They also provide an early indication of how the UAE may divide responsibilities between humans and autonomous systems.

80,000 Government Workers Will Be Trained

The transition is also a massive workforce programme.

In May, the UAE Cabinet approved an Agentic AI skills programme covering approximately 80,000 federal government employees.

Training will span five categories:

  • leadership
  • technical employees
  • specialists
  • general workforce
  • train-the-trainer participants

The government also plans to develop an AI-powered digital training platform that can assess employees' capabilities and provide personalised learning programmes based on their jobs and skills.

This is important because the UAE's strategy does not publicly frame Agentic AI simply as a replacement for government employees.

Instead, government workers are expected increasingly to become users, supervisors, designers, evaluators, and managers of AI-powered systems.

The Data Infrastructure Is Already Enormous

The UAE is also entering the agentic era with an established government data and performance infrastructure.

In July 2025, the government launched its Proactive Government Performance System, an AI-powered platform capable of processing more than 150 million data points every month.

The system is designed to generate more than 50,000 proactive insights annually and potentially save more than 250,000 working hours per year.

It uses AI analytics and predictive technologies to monitor government performance, track strategic objectives, generate reports, and help leaders anticipate future challenges.

That infrastructure helps explain why the UAE may be able to experiment with agentic government faster than countries that are still attempting to integrate databases across separate ministries.

Agentic AI becomes much more powerful when government systems can securely access consistent, interoperable data.

But Who Is Responsible When an AI Agent Gets It Wrong?

This is where the UAE experiment becomes globally important.

Imagine an AI system involved in:

Taxation.

Licensing.

Procurement.

Healthcare administration.

Immigration services.

Government benefits.

Regulatory compliance.

Policy analysis.

What happens when the AI makes an incorrect decision?

Who carries legal responsibility?

The software provider?

The government department?

The official supervising the agent?

The minister responsible for the agency?

And what mechanism allows a citizen to challenge an automated outcome?

These questions become increasingly important as AI moves from recommendation to execution.

The UAE has already adopted broader AI principles covering responsible use, privacy, data protection, security, and compliance with legislation.

But large-scale Agentic AI creates a different governance problem because an agent may potentially perform a sequence of actions rather than simply generate a single answer.

Every additional degree of autonomy raises questions about logging, explainability, auditability, access controls, escalation, human review, and accountability.

The Most Important Document May Not Be an AI Model

Much of the world's attention will naturally focus on what technology the UAE selects.

But the more important development may be the task-classification framework now being discussed.

That framework could eventually answer questions such as:

Which government tasks may AI execute automatically?

Which require human approval?

Which may only receive AI recommendations?

Which decisions should never be delegated to an autonomous system?

That is the governance architecture every country pursuing Agentic AI will eventually need.

Because there is a major difference between allowing an AI agent to schedule an appointment and allowing one to determine whether a citizen qualifies for a government benefit.
